Well, this experiment has been going since the last 7 days of 2008 and I’m not slowing down. I do have my slow times, and I do have my fast times, but overall my interest and excitement about this comic is steady and healthy. This has never really happened to me before. I always tend to burn out at some point. But so far, so good!

I guess this is to be expected though. This really is a sort of dream project for me. It’s 100% controlled and created by me, so I owe no one. I’m not crushed by deadlines or concerns over money. It’s just pure creative fun. I’m creating and exploring a world of my dreams. Isn’t that what gets most of us into doing comics in the first place?

So right now I’ve sketched and lettered my way into episode #51, ahead of the curve in terms of prep work. Just need to focus on putting the inks and colors to these and post them up.

One thing I am 98% certain of is that I will change the format very soon to mini-comic/manga, which is basically a 4.25″ x 5.5″ size. From the moment I conceived this series a couple of years back I wanted to create a mini-comic fantasy series and actually sell printed copies. That’s a secondary concern, but I don’t see any reason to not do it.

Naola’s Apartment

Monday, September 7th, 2009

naolasplace
Low Streets District is adjacent to Palace Place, where the Palace of the Prince tops the city. She can easily see the Palace dome from her balcony.

Her apartment is on the top floor of her building. It isn’t large, but it is comfortable and private. Adventurers with any experience tend to make decent gold so she can afford better, but she’s a penny pincher. She’s saving her coins for better gear and better henchfolk.

Her apartment appears to be one large living area probably with a pantry or other storage space and a spacious balcony. Though she doesn’t like the idea of paying higher rent, she does think it would be a good idea to move somewhere she can actually practice archery without accidentally killing her neighbors.
